#!/bin/sh
#
# Startup script for Nessus 
#
# chkconfig: 345 85 15
# description: Nessus is a security auditing tool
# processname: nessusd
# pidfile: /var/run/nessusd.pid
# config: /etc/nessusd.conf


# Source function library.
. /etc/rc.d/init.d/functions

# See how we were called.
case "$1" in
  start)
	echo -n "Starting nessus: "
	if [ -f /var/lock/subsys/nessusd ] ; then
		echo
		exit 1
	fi

	/usr/sbin/nessusd >/var/log/nessusd 2>&1 &
	echo nessusd
	touch /var/lock/subsys/nessusd
	;;
  stop)
	echo -n "Shutting down nessus: "
	killproc nessusd
	echo
	rm -f /var/lock/subsys/nessusd
	;;
  status)
	status nessusd
	;;
  restart)
	$0 stop
	$0 start
	;;
  *)
	echo "Usage: $0 {start|stop|restart|status}"
	exit 1
esac

exit 0
